Beyond Limits: Exploring UK Casinos Not on GamStop

 

In recent years, the UK gambling landscape has experienced significant changes, particularly due to the introduction and enforcement of the GamStop self-exclusion scheme. Designed to help individuals struggling with gambling problems, GamStop all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from participating in online gambling activities across licensed UK operators. However, a growing number of players are seeking alternatives—specifically UK casinos not on GamStop. These platforms operate outside the jurisdiction of the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) and are gaining popularity for various reasons.

Casinos not on GamStop typically hold licenses from foreign regulators,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the Curacao eGaming Commission. This international licensing gives them the flexibility to operate independently of the UKGC’s rules, including the mandatory implementation of GamStop. As a result, these casinos are accessible even to those who have registered with GamStop, offering a path back into gambling without restriction.

The appeal of these casinos lies in their less restrictive approach. Players are often drawn to them because of more generous bonuses, broader game selections, and fewer limitations on deposit amounts or betting sizes. Some platforms even support cryptocurrency payments, allowing for faster transactions and enhanced privacy. This level of freedom, while attractive to many, comes with a set of responsibilities and risks that players must understand.

One of the main concerns surrounding non-GamStop casinos is player protection. Because they are not regulated by the UKGC, these casinos may not follow the same strict guidelines on responsible gambling, data security, or dispute resolution. While many of them are still trustworthy and reputable, the absence of UKGC oversight means that players must do their due diligence before registering or depositing funds. Reading independent reviews, checking licensing information, and testing customer support can help mitigate these risks.

Additionally, using non-GamStop casinos can be controversial for those who originally opted into self-exclusion to combat problem gambling. Bypassing GamStop may offer temporary relief or enjoyment, but it can also undermine the purpose of self-exclusion and potentially worsen compulsive behavior. Therefore, anyone considering these platforms should reflect carefully on their motivations and current relationship with gambling.

It is also worth noting that while these casinos are accessible to UK players, they often structure their operations in ways that skirt local laws without directly breaking them. This legal gray area allows them to exist but also means that players have limited recourse in the event of a dispute. Unlike with UK-licensed sites, users cannot appeal to the UKGC for assistance.
